Theater League is a not-for-profit civic performing arts organization dedicated to enhancing the quality of life in the communities it serves with the thrill of live! theater. Founded by Mark Edelman in Kansas City in 1977, the organization has presented the Best of Broadway in theaters across the country to well over a million patrons. Today, we dedicate ourselves to supporting professional theater through grants, student ticket subsidies and new works development in our hometown of Kansas City and around the country.

losttrust
According to ransomware.live, LostTrust is a double-extortion ransomware operation that emerged in March 2023 and publicized over 50 victims within days of launching its leak site in September 2023, believed to be a rebrand of the MetaEncryptor gang, primarily targeting manufacturing, professional services, construction, and education sectors with 71% of known victims in the US.
